Is it illegal to take drugs in Ireland?

Drug use in itself is not generally a crime under Irish law but possession of a controlled drug, without due authorisation, is an offence under Section 3 of the Misuse of Drugs Act 1977. The legislation makes a distinction between possession for personal use and possession for sale or supply.

What is the most popular drug in Ireland?

Cannabis
Cannabis was the main problem drug for 24.7% of all cases entering drug treatment in Ireland in 2017 and was the most common main problem drug reported by new cases (39.1%). The 2014/15 ESPAD survey reported that 18.9% of 15‒16-year-old students had used cannabis during their lifetime.

Does Ireland have a red light district?

Dublin’s sex trade was largely centred on the Monto district, reputedly the largest red light district in Europe. A major part of the demand came from the large number of British army military personnel stationed in Ireland at the time.
